bp Leaders For Life

Investing in our People. Investing in our Future. 

bp Leaders for Life is SLSNZ's premier leadership development programme for current and emerging club leaders aged 20-35 years.

This program offers a valuable opportunity for participants to enhance their leadership abilities, deepen their knowledge, and develop key skills. It also fosters the creation of meaningful relationships and connections across clubs and regions throughout New Zealand. The content of the program is designed to support personal and professional growth beyond the realm of surf lifesaving. Ultimately, the goal is to empower individuals to lead their clubs and our movement towards a sustainable and thriving future.

bp Leaders for Life Programme Philosophy

  • Strength-based: Builds on existing strengths and the application of those strengths to be an effective leader
  • Tailored: Informed by both individual aspirations and requirements of the leadership role.
  • Personal responsibility: Leaders take responsibility for their own learning and application of that learning.
  • Accessible: Leadership support is available when it's needed.
  • Development support: Adult learning principles; 'learn - do - reflect'

Thanks to the support of SLSNZ’s major partner bp, the programme – which normally costs $4500 per person – is heavily subsidised, resulting in a reduced fee of only $450 per person (which includes travel and accommodation). Clubs may apply for central government funding to cover their candidate's portion of the course costs. Successful candidates attend a series of workshops across the country throughout the year, each focused on a different set of leadership skills.

Application Criteria

  • Current SLSNZ member
  • Aged between 20 - 35 years
  • Participants will be current or emerging leaders at club level
  • You need to commit to attending all 5 workshops throughout the country
  • You will have aspirations to make a real difference and recognise your need to develop as a leader
  • Your club must endorse your application and provide a letter of support outlining your suitability to attend the bp Leaders for Life 
  • Once applications have closed, a short list of candidates will be selected to proceed through to an interview stage. From then, a group of 17 candidates will be selected for this year's programme

FAQs

Who is eligible? All SLSNZ/NR members aged 20-35 are eligible to apply

Is there a cost? The majority of this progamme is funded by bp and supported by SLSNZ. As with most member education - there is a user pays charge. For this programme the amount is $450, which will be invoiced to your club on the completion. The club will then have the option of paying for it, or asking the user to pay

Can I apply to be a part of a programme even if I've already participated in an SLSNZ leadership programme in the past? Absolutely!

When does bp Leaders for Life start and how long does it go for? The programme starts inJuly/August each year and runs for 10 months, usually finishing around May

Can I do the programme with friends? Your friends may also apply, but there is no guarantee that they will be on the programme with you. However, you will definitely make a great deal of new friends and contacts through bp Leaders for Life, so don't be worried if you don't know anyone at first

Can SLSNZ staff be a part of bp Leaders for Life? Yes, as long as they are a member of a club and involved in leadership

Leadership Mentor

Mentors are the key link between the skills taught in our bp Leaders for Life Leadership programme and the integration of these skills into practice. They will serve as a key support resource for candidates in programme, have a passion for enabling people to reach their potential and a genuine interest in the development of leaders.

Candidates are a mix of emerging and experienced leaders who are actively involved in some form of leadership at club or regional level.

Graduates in our last programme benefited immensely from their mentors assisting with their leadership development. This aligns with our national leadership and member development strategies. By growing leaders and developing programmes to nurture emerging leaders, our whole organisation benefits. This mentor role adds another layer of leadership growth to each candidate.

 

What are we looking for?

  • We are looking for 8-10 leadership mentors from around New Zealand to support participants in the 2025/26 bp Leaders for Life programme.
  • We are especially looking for people with a genuine interest in the development of leaders, strong empathy for people and a passion for enabling people to reach their potential.
  • Mentors who have experience in mentoring or coaching people in their own development, either within surf lifesaving and/or their professional lives. They will understand the principles of effective mentoring and will be able to point to a track record of developing people.
  • Mentors to support candidates who will be a mix of emerging and experienced leaders and who will be actively involved in some form of leadership at club or regional level.

Each mentor will be paired with 2 programme candidates. The leadership mentors will be expected to meet (face to face or online) with their paired candidate a minimum of 8 times during the programme. Mentors will also be required to meet with the Programme leads following every workshop.

It is likely that each mentor will retain an on-going mentoring relationship with their candidates for the 12 months following the programme. In some cases, these relationships may extend over a number of years, or become lifelong.

Each candidate will, with their mentor will establish an appropriate personal development plan based on their TMS Personal Profile, current leadership challenges and future ambitions.

Mentors will attend the final bp Leaders for Life workshop to watch their candidate’s leadership presentations, to be held on Saturday 9th May 2026.
